Uncertainty exists widely in complex systems, such as autonomous robotics, smart grids, industrial processes, and multi-agent networks, where dynamic interactions, incomplete data, and nonlinear behaviors pose significant challenges. These uncertainties may arise from fuzzy parameters, probabilistic disturbances, imprecise measurements, or incomplete knowledge, necessitating advanced modeling and control strategies. Intelligent control approaches including adaptive learning, AI-driven decision-making, and hybrid model-based data-driven techniques are essential to address these challenges while ensuring robustness and efficiency.
We invite contributions on theories, algorithms, and real-world implementations that bridge complex system modeling with intelligent control under uncertainty. Submissions may cover uncertainty quantification in complex system modeling, learning-based control optimization, or interdisciplinary applications demonstrating robustness in uncertain environments.
This research topic focuses on uncertainty-aware modeling and intelligent control in complex systems, leveraging methodologies such as: (1) uncertainty representation with fuzzy sets, rough sets, Dempster–Shafer theory, and/or probabilistic graphical models. (2) Machine learning for control with reinforcement learning, deep neural networks, and/or transfer learning for adaptive system behavior. (3) Fusion and decision-making with Bayesian inference, Kalman filtering, and/or Dempster evidence-based fusion rules to integrate heterogeneous data. (4) Applications in resilient power systems, autonomous vehicles, and/or biomedical engineering.
